PDF Days Europe 2021 in Berlin and Online

PDF Days 2021

Preparations are in full swing: PDF Days Europe will take place in September 2021. It is one of the best-known and largest events focused on PDF technology. This year, you can participate online and on site in Berlin.

This year, the agenda once again offers a strong mix of high-quality presentations, training, and networking opportunities. All presentations will be streamed live to provide a full online experience. As a hybrid event, it gives attendees maximum flexibility.

Safety Concept Due to COVID-19

The event was adapted to current conditions in cooperation with the venue and includes a comprehensive safety concept. The so-called 3G concept ("Tested - Vaccinated - Recovered") ensures that only recovered, vaccinated, or tested people can access the event area. This applies to participants, staff, and speakers.

Both the organiser (PDF Association e.V.) and the venue (Steglitz International Hotel, SI Hotel), together with local security services in Berlin, ensure that all current COVID regulations are implemented.

The Agenda 2021

This year's programme offers high-quality presentations on the world's most popular digital document format, PDF, as well as various networking opportunities.

The "Technical Days" take place on September 27 and 28, 2021, and are primarily aimed at developers, integrators, and other interested professionals. The "Solution Day" on September 29, 2021, is tailored more to users.

What Awaits Participants?

The introduction will be given by CEO Duff Johnson. Overall, attendees can expect detailed information about the PDF Association's initiatives over the past year and its future plans. True to the motto "PDF experts come together", the event focuses entirely on PDF technology and its broad range of applications. In addition, Technical Days sessions are explicitly vendor-neutral and avoid product promotion.

PDF Days 2021: Overview of Presentation Topics

  • Create PDFs using HTML: how to use HTML to generate PDF documents
  • How to make e-Signing interoperable: Getting rid of proprietary data and closed workflows
  • PDF/A Conversion and Validation Challenges
  • Validating digital signatures in PDF: About user experiences and pitfalls
  • Two Standards, One Goal, Modernizing Print Communication Production: PDF+JDF=ADF
  • Cryptography in PDF: future perspectives
  • STOP PRESS, or how to avoid it: how to streamline problematic PDFs into the print workflow
  • Content Authenticity and PDF: Support of PDF as part of the Coalition for Content Provenance and Authenticity
  • Archiving email - as PDF? The current state of discussions and developments in the field of interoperable email archival
  • SafeDocs - towards a more secure future: Securing file formats through provable techniques
  • A work-in-progress: PDF/R revisions and new, highly compressed image format
  • Making sense of PDF structures in the wild at scale
  • WCAG or PDF/UA: what's the difference
  • The Low Code Revolution and PDF: What does it mean for PDF Developers and PDF Technology Companies?
  • Accessible PDF - How to tag content the right way: Finding appropriate Tags for content
  • Future of Traversing PDF Files: SELECT future FROM pdf.*;
  • What makes a tagged PDF a proper tagged PDF/UA document? Let us show you how the Matterhorn Protocol helps to generate a PDF/UA compliant document
  • OpenType color fonts in PDF: Implementing emoji and other colored symbols in PDF
  • Lessons from implementing a PDF/UA-centric mobile reader: What we've learned while making a better mobile experience
  • 3DPDFs + the future
  • Content accessibility for all screen sizes
  • The Arlington PDF Model: A specification-derived, machine-readable definition of PDF
  • Deriving HTML from PDF - lessons learned
  • Survey of open-source PDF solutions

The talks are held in English.
